Re: THE RIGHT TIRE & WHEEL

Quote:
Originally Posted by Bones_GSXR
Just switched to the Hancook Dynapro MT in 37x13.50-20. with 12oz of Dynabeads in ea they are quiet and handle great on and off. Switched from Kuhmo (studded and sipped them for winter) and had my Terra Grapplers on after the snow went while I waited for the Hancook's to come in. The Terra Grapplers in the same 37x13.50-20 wander a lot.
One of these days post back on how they wear/mileage. I almost went that way but opted for the Toyo's cause they were in stock. Hankook's were cheaper and got a great rating.
